Updated beta! 5.2.1 (486)
-
-
Search other areas on the map.
Checked and working well.
-
Vehicle specific (online) search suggestions.
Checked and working well.
I used By foot as transport mode and the app suggested places for drinking water, picnic stops, shelters etc etc all were correct.
I then used Bicycle, some bicycle shops and bicycle repair places were missing from my local area but others were found, that’s map data not the app.
As I live in a tourist area Motorhome transport mode gives me a long list of campsites and facilities locally. I also checked this in other areas of the UK and it worked perfectly.
There are some motorcycle shop/repair places missing in Motorcycle mode but again that’s missing map data.
So to summarise I would say that vehicle specific search is working well.
